How does AnoKath® TW work in drinking water treatment?

Electrochemical cells, used in the drinking water treatment process to ensure drinking water hygiene, form the core of AnoKath® TW. These cells generate oxidizing agents that destroy organic compounds and kill microorganisms. AnoKath® TW disinfects the drinking water and eliminates unwanted tastes and odors. The result is clear, refreshing water that meets the strictest quality standards.

This technology utilizes the principle of electrolysis, in which targeted electrical currents generate active disinfectants. These disinfectants, such as chlorine, are produced directly in the water and ensure that harmful microorganisms have no chance of survival. This process is extremely efficient and enables continuous, real-time treatment of drinking water.

What is the difference between drinking water treatment and drinking water disinfection?

Drinking water treatment is the umbrella term: it encompasses everything that improves water quality (e.g., filtration, removal of odors/turbidity, reduction of biofilm in the system). Drinking water disinfection is a part of this and primarily aims at hygienic stabilization against germs.

When do I really need a drinking water treatment system?

Water treatment is typically beneficial when water comes from a cistern, well, rainwater tank, or IBC container , when pipes are rarely used, or when you experience recurring problems such as odor, deposits, biofilm, or cloudy water. Treatment is also often the key to maintaining consistent water quality in animal drinking troughs or irrigation systems.

How can I tell if my water system needs treatment?

Typical signs include:

  • unpleasant smell or taste
  • Cloudiness , streaks, deposits
  • Biofilm in hoses/pipes
  • Algae growth in the tank
  • clogged filters/drinking troughs, frequent malfunctions

What is the most common mistake in drinking water treatment?

The most common mistake: treating "the water" but ignoring what will later re-contaminate everything – tank walls, pipes, hoses, drinking troughs, and extraction points . If biofilm remains in the system, the contamination will keep returning.

What would be a sensible process for processing in everyday life?

A practical concept consists of:

  • Check the source (tank/well/container)
  • Clean mechanically (where possible), remove deposits
  • Stabilize system hygiene (pipes/hoses/sampling points)
  • Use the appropriate filtration (depending on the type of dirt/particles)
  • Establish a routine (monitoring, hotspots, intervals)
